Ernst Heinrich Roth Violin, 1924, MarkneukirchenA beautiful violin by Ernst Heinrich Roth made in 1924 in Markneukirchen, Germany. Labeled, "Ernst Heinrich Roth Markneukirchen 1924 Reproduction of Antonius Stradivarius Cremona 1714 Germany." Branded to the inside back, "Ernnst Heinrich Roth Markneukirchen." More photos to come.
